What is JSF Twitter?

JSF Twitter refers to the integration of JavaServer Faces technology with the Twitter API, allowing developers to create dynamic web applications that interact with Twitter's vast ecosystem. By utilizing JSF, developers can build user interfaces that are both responsive and interactive, enhancing the overall user experience. This integration opens up a world of possibilities, enabling applications to display Twitter feeds, send tweets, and even gather analytics on user interactions.

How Does JSF Twitter Work?

The functionality of JSF Twitter hinges on several key components:

  • JavaServer Faces (JSF): A powerful Java specification for building component-based user interfaces for web applications.
  • Twitter API: A set of programming interfaces that allow developers to interact with Twitter's data and services.
  • Integration: The process of combining JSF components with Twitter's functionalities, allowing for interactive features such as displaying tweets, timelines, and user interactions.
